
The Ange Postecoglou era at Celtic might be over, after the Australian manager decided to leave the club in order to take the Tottenham Hotspur job this summer. His influence still continues to be felt at Parkhead though and the club have signed a player on a permanent basis, who was brought in on loan earlier this year.
That player in question is none other than Tomoki Iwata. The versatile Japanese star was brought in from Postecoglou’s former club, Yokohama F. Marinos, on an initial loan deal.
That has been made permanent now and Iwata will be staying on at Celtic Park. It remains to be seen how he does next season under the management of Brendan Rodgers.
As reported by Yokohama F. Marinos’ official website, Iwata has decided to permanently transfer to Celtic and the player said:
“I have decided to make a permanent transfer to Celtic FC. I can only thank Oita Trinita and Yokohama F. Marinos for making my dream come true.
Winning the championship last season is a sight I will never forget in my football life. Every day’s practice was fun, and every week I was able to share the victory with the Marinos family, and the two years I spent at F. Marinos was a very fulfilling time. I am glad that I moved to F. Marinos, and I would like to do my best in my own way so that I can think that my move to Celtic FC is also a good thing.

Iwata was fantastic for Yokohama F. Marinos and one of the best players in the J-League. So when Celtic signed him, he came in with huge expectations.
Till now, Iwata has looked decent in the chances that he has gotten and he has shown glimpses of his quality. But we are clearly yet to see the best of the Japanese star. Hopefully, that will come next season, now that he has had a taste of the Scottish game and will have a pre-season under his belt as well.
Iwata was mostly an option off the bench in the second half of last season though he got to play a decent amount of football towards the end of the campaign, when Cameron Carter-Vickers was out injured. According to stats from Transfermarkt, he has 18 appearances and played 777 minutes of football for Celtic till now.
Iwata is expected to improve next season. Hopefully, there is a lot more to come from the 2022 J-League MVP.
